Abstract

PROBLEM TO BE SOLVED: To provide a manufacturing method of a waterproof shoe in which production efficiency is improved by simplifying joining of a waterproof liner sleeve and an upper. SOLUTION: The method is provided with a process for producing the upper having an upper opening and a lower opening, a process for producing the waterproof liner sleeve having an upper opening and a lower opening and arranged along the inner surface of the upper, a process for positioning the edge of the lower opening of the waterproof liner sleeve at a position close to the lower opening of the upper and deeper than the lower opening and joining the neighborhood of the lower opening of the upper and the neighborhood of the lower opening of the waterproof liner sleeve only with an adhesive, and a process for fitting a sole to the edge of the lower opening of the upper.

Description of the Related Art The lining of a waterproof shoe, which is lined with a sock-shaped lining formed of a breathable waterproof sheet, has an upper opening and a lower opening, and the upper opening is joined to the upper opening of the upper. A sole region is formed by providing an outsole and an insole along the lower opening of the lining.

However, the lining has a problem that it is easily damaged and loses its waterproofness when it is subjected to pressure from the foot or mechanical pressure during walking. Therefore, the following invention is proposed to solve the problem. It had been.

For example, in the shoe disclosed in US Pat. No. 5,526,584, a sock-like shoe insert that is breathable and waterproof is made of a stretchable material, and the shoe insert and the sole region are sewn together. Is configured.

However, since the liner sleeve and the upper are joined by stitching, there is a problem that the joining work is troublesome.

Further, the shoe disclosed in US Pat. No. 5,678,326 has a shoe insert formed of a breathable waterproof sheet with a lining arranged on the back surface of the lower part of the upper and the inner peripheral side of the shoe insert. A sandwich structure is formed by adhering to the above with an adhesive. That is, the sole region portion of the shoe insert is fixed between the insole and the outsole and is also fixed to the lining, so that the shoe has a strong structure.

However, when manufacturing such a shoe, there is a drawback in that the manufacturing process is complicated because it is necessary to dispose the shoe insert in the fixing step of the sole.

Also, US patent application Ser. No. 09/591201
The publication discloses a shoe with a drainage hole through which water that has penetrated inside can be discharged. This shoe includes an upper that covers the upper of the foot and has an upper opening and a lower opening, and a liner sleeve that covers the upper of the foot and has an upper opening and a lower opening, and the liner is provided at a lower opening edge of the upper. The lower opening edge of the sleeve is sewn together, and the seam between the liner sleeve and the upper is covered with a waterproof seal. This prevents water that has entered along the seam between the liner sleeve and the upper from reaching the interior of the shoe due to the presence of the waterproof seal.

However, since the liner sleeve and the upper are joined by stitching, there is a problem that the joining work is troublesome, a skilled worker is required for joining, and the production cost becomes high.
